Output 10068992e1d75f10fd0d6f8cda743f96d4d07b4b1395669b49c2858d16ee81c3:0

value
2323622
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d878f48f6995e9ce0429917c53a984b827ea2226 OP_EQUAL
address
3MRcn6r8FQcLuefyLDqGoowWKrCQD44uqL
transaction
10068992e1d75f10fd0d6f8cda743f96d4d07b4b1395669b49c2858d16ee81c3
spent
true